2014 Supreme(SC) 1213

SUDHANSU JYOTI MUKHOPADHAYA, VIKRAMAJIT SEN
Mishrilal – Appellant
Versus
State of M. P. – Respondent


Advocate Appeared:
For the Petitioner:Sunil Verma, P.C. Raghunandan and Rameshwar Prasad Goyal, Advocates.
For the Respondent:Sakshi Kakkar, Shweta Singh and C.D. Singh, Advocates.

ORDER :

Sudhansu Jyoti Mukhopadhaya, J.

Leave granted.

2. This appeal has been preferred by the appellant against the order dated 13th September, 2013 passed by the High Court of Madhya Pradesh Bench at Indore in Criminal Appeal No. 636 of 2009. By the impugned order, the High Court refused to suspend the sentence and grant bail. The learned counsel appearing on behalf of the appellant submitted that the appellant has been convicted for the offence under Sections 8/15, 8/25 of NDPS Act by the Trial Court and to undergo rigorous imprisonment of ten years and out of which he has already spent more than eight years in custody.

3. The learned counsel appearing on behalf of the respondent submits that 24.22 quintal of poppy-straw was recovered from the appellant and, therefore, he was convicted for the offence.

4. Having heard the learned counsel for the parties and taking into consideration the facts and circumstances of the case, we allow the prayer, set aside the impugned order dated 13.09.2013 passed by the High Court of Madhya Pradesh in Criminal Appeal No. 636 of 2009, suspend the sentence and enlarge the appellant on bail in connection with Special S.T.
